Brand name: "Danko Field Elephant" Trousers and Jacket with reflecting stripe on the back. 280THB in local outdoor stores. The set comes in orange, dark green, blue.

I have a set since 3 years and I cover distances of 200km, even, or when I cannot avoid it, in rain. The trousers and Jacket kept me dry until today, and no flapping at all, highly recommended for the cost-conscious rider.

There are a number of motorcycle shops around town that will sell you something sturdy that doesn't blow over your head on a bike, because it is made for bike riding - just over a grand for the jacket and pants, and well worth it. they are also vented, so you don't get as hot as you would in a bin liner. Try 'The Paddock' on Rachadapisek - they have a decent set for 1300 baht.

I would caution against Paddock in Ratchada in Bangkok, If you know your stuff, they have some decent things, but when I was a total newbie there they sold me old stock helmets and gloves, after I have found other shops like Panda Rider and Dirt Shop I rare go back there for anything, Last time I was there the boots selection was quite good though, and parts like visors are always in stock, compared to Panda rider that might need to order one it for you.

Back to topic though, I use the outer layer of Columbia camping jacket to wear over my normal riding jacket and that works pretty well

In Pattaya, the Mityon Shop both the main office opposite Tony's and Kawasaki and new Big Honda Showrooms on Sukhumvit have plenty of jackets, even the branded 'sport' jacket (like a shell suit jacket) with no protection works better in the rain than the emergency plastic one you get from Supermarkets. I bought one in an emergency once to ride back from Trad, by the time I got to Rayong it has completely disintegrated, quite funny actually.
